2. Types of Mercedes-Benz Window Wipers
Mercedes-Benz vehicles use various types of wiper blades, each designed to provide optimal performance based on the vehicle’s model and year. Understanding these types will help you choose the right replacement wipers for your car.
2.1. Standard Hook Wiper Blades
Standard hook wiper blades are the most common type found on older Mercedes-Benz models. They attach to the wiper arm via a simple hook mechanism, making them easy to install and replace.
2.2. Flat Wiper Blades
Flat wiper blades, also known as beam blades, are a modern design that provides uniform pressure across the windshield. They are more aerodynamic and less prone to lifting at high speeds, offering superior performance compared to standard blades. Many newer Mercedes-Benz models use flat wiper blades.
2.3. Push Button Wiper Blades
Push button wiper blades feature a specific connector that attaches to the wiper arm using a push-button mechanism. This type of fitting is common on many contemporary Mercedes-Benz vehicles.
2.4. Pinch Tab Wiper Blades
Pinch tab wiper blades utilize a pinch tab connector to secure the blade to the wiper arm. This design ensures a snug fit and reliable performance.
2.5. Side Pin Wiper Blades
Side pin wiper blades have a pin on the side of the wiper arm that fits into a corresponding hole on the blade. This type of fitting is less common but can be found on certain Mercedes-Benz models.

5. How to Replace Mercedes-Benz Window Wipers
Replacing your Mercedes-Benz window wipers is a straightforward process that can be done at home with a few simple tools.
5.1. Tools You’ll Need
- New wiper blades
- Gloves (optional)
- Soft cloth or towel
5.2. Step-by-Step Instructions
- Lift the Wiper Arm: Gently lift the wiper arm away from the windshield. Be careful not to let the arm snap back against the glass, as this can cause damage.
- Remove the Old Blade: Depending on the type of wiper blade, you may need to press a release tab, pinch the sides, or rotate the blade to detach it from the wiper arm. Refer to your vehicle’s owner’s manual or the wiper blade packaging for specific instructions.
- Attach the New Blade: Align the new wiper blade with the wiper arm and attach it securely. Ensure that the blade clicks into place or is properly fastened according to the manufacturer’s instructions.
- Lower the Wiper Arm: Carefully lower the wiper arm back onto the windshield.
- Test the Wipers: Turn on the ignition and activate the wipers to ensure they are working correctly and cleaning the windshield effectively.
5.3. Tips for Easy Replacement
- Replace both wiper blades simultaneously to ensure even wear and optimal performance.
- Clean the windshield thoroughly before installing new wiper blades to remove any dirt or debris that could damage the blades.
- Consult your vehicle’s owner’s manual or watch a video tutorial for specific instructions on replacing the wiper blades on your Mercedes-Benz model. CARDIAGTECH.NET provides a range of fitting videos to assist you.

7. Common Problems with Mercedes-Benz Window Wipers
Even with proper maintenance, wiper blades can experience problems that affect their performance.
7.1. Streaking
Streaking occurs when the wiper blades leave streaks of water or debris on the windshield. This can be caused by worn or damaged blades, a dirty windshield, or improper wiper arm alignment.
7.2. Skipping
Skipping happens when the wiper blades jump or skip across the windshield instead of smoothly wiping away water. This can be caused by a dry windshield, worn blades, or bent wiper arms.
7.3. Squeaking
Squeaking is a common problem that occurs when the wiper blades make a squealing noise as they move across the windshield. This can be caused by dry blades, a dirty windshield, or worn rubber.
7.4. Not Cleaning Properly
If your wiper blades are not cleaning the windshield effectively, it may be due to worn or damaged blades, a dirty windshield, or improper wiper arm pressure.
8. Troubleshooting Mercedes-Benz Window Wipers
Here are some troubleshooting tips for common wiper blade problems:
8.1. Streaking Solutions
- Clean the wiper blades and windshield thoroughly.
- Replace the wiper blades if they are worn or damaged.
- Check the wiper arm alignment and adjust if necessary.
8.2. Skipping Solutions
- Wet the windshield before using the wipers.
- Replace the wiper blades if they are worn or damaged.
- Check the wiper arm tension and adjust if necessary.
8.3. Squeaking Solutions
- Clean the wiper blades and windshield thoroughly.
- Apply a small amount of silicone lubricant to the wiper blades.
- Replace the wiper blades if they are worn or damaged.
8.4. Not Cleaning Properly Solutions
- Clean the wiper blades and windshield thoroughly.
- Replace the wiper blades if they are worn or damaged.
- Check the wiper arm pressure and adjust if necessary.

12. Understanding Wiper Blade Technology
Modern wiper blades incorporate advanced technologies to enhance their performance and durability.
12.1. Beam Blade Technology
Beam blades, also known as flat blades, use a single piece of rubber that is tensioned along its entire length. This design provides uniform pressure across the windshield, resulting in streak-free wiping and improved visibility.
12.2. Hybrid Blade Technology
Hybrid blades combine the features of both conventional and beam blades. They have a traditional frame design with a flat blade insert, providing a balance of performance and durability.
12.3. Silicone Blade Technology
Silicone wiper blades are made from a durable silicone compound that resists cracking, tearing, and wear. They provide excellent wiping performance and can last up to twice as long as traditional rubber blades.
12.4. Teflon Coating Technology
Some wiper blades feature a Teflon coating that reduces friction and improves wiping performance. The Teflon coating helps the blade glide smoothly across the windshield, resulting in streak-free wiping and reduced noise.
